Don't like the round WSII? Me Neither! Check out my new axle-back!

So all the pics I have seen from Apex show that the axle-back WSII is the oval cannister style muffler, I love it. But the actual item you recieve is a round case that hangs way too low for my taste. So I decided to run the universal WSII with left inlet, I picked up a flange so I could remove it later and replace it with the stock piece. Anyways, check it out and let me know what you think!

I got the muffler from TH motorsports for $204 shipped. Probably could have got it for cheaper but it is what it is. The left in let allows for easier mounting as that is what the stock muffler is, left inlet.

The suspension is TEIN basic coilovers, all the way to da bottom, hehe.

The blades are going to be replaced by soem 16 inch polished slips for a while, until I get bored and go back to my all time favorite Honda wheels, the BLADES.
